What Are the Advantages of Lifetime Balance and Rotation for Your Tires?

The advantages of lifetime balance and rotation for your tires include improved tire longevity, enhanced vehicle safety, and better fuel efficiency.

  1. Improved Tire Longevity
  2. Enhanced Vehicle Safety
  3. Better Fuel Efficiency
  4. Reduced Noise and Vibration
  5. Cost-Effectiveness

Lifetime balance and rotation for your tires lead to improved tire longevity. Properly balanced tires wear evenly, extending their life. According to the Tire Industry Association, regular rotation can add thousands of miles to tire lifespan. For instance, a study by the Rubber Manufacturers Association found that tires can last 30% longer with regular maintenance.

Enhanced vehicle safety is another advantage of lifetime balance and rotation. Unbalanced tires can cause uneven wear and reduce traction, leading to safety hazards.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ration emphasizes that uneven wear can impair braking and handling. For example, a well-maintained car with properly aligned tires can help prevent accidents on wet or slippery roads.

Better fuel efficiency occurs when tires are properly balanced and rotated. Uneven tire wear can increase rolling resistance, prompting the engine to work harder and consume more fuel. The U.S. Department of Energy states that maintaining proper tire pressure and balance can improve gas mileage by up to 3%, leading to significant savings over time.

Reduced noise and vibration also result from lifetime balance and rotation. Unbalanced tires or irregular wear can create vibrations that affect the driving experience. A smoother ride contributes to greater driver comfort and minimizes distractions.

Finally, cost-effectiveness is an essential consideration. While some may view routine maintenance as an extra expense, it can lead to significant savings on tire replacements and fuel costs. Studies indicate that neglecting tire maintenance could lead to spending 5% more on fuel and replacing tires 20% sooner than with regular care.

  1. Regular Tire Rotation:
    Regular tire rotation refers to changing the position of tires on the vehicle. The purpose is to ensure even tire wear. According to Tire Industry Association (TIA), rotating tires every 5,000 to 7,500 miles is advised. For instance, front tires may experience more wear on front-wheel-drive vehicles. Thus, rotating tires prevents uneven wear and extends the life of all tires.

  2. Wheel Balancing:
    Wheel balancing involves adjusting the weight distribution of the tires and wheels. Properly balanced wheels help eliminate vibrations during driving. The American Automobile Association (AAA) suggests that unbalanced tires can lead to premature tire wear and may decrease fuel efficiency. By maintaining balanced wheels, drivers can enhance comfort and the vehicle’s overall performance.

  3. Tire Alignment Checks:
    Tire alignment checks assess whether the vehicle’s wheels are aligned with each other and the road. Misalignment can cause steering issues and increased tire wear.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) recommends alignment checks whenever new tires are installed or if you notice any unusual handling. Maintaining proper alignment enhances safety while driving.

  4. Increased Tire Lifespan:
    With consistent maintenance like balancing and rotation, tires can last longer. According to a study by Consumer Reports (2020), regular tire rotations can add up to 4,000 miles to the life of a tire. Longer-lasting tires also translate to reduced costs in replacements over time.

  5. Improved Vehicle Handling and Safety:
    Regular tire maintenance significantly impacts handling and safety. According to the National Safety Council (NSC), well-maintained tires contribute to better traction and braking distances. This can be crucial for overall vehicle safety, particularly in adverse weather conditions, like rain or snow.
